一个云服务器能搭建几个宝塔?

一个云服务器理论上可以安装多个宝塔面板,但实际操作中通常建议每个云服务器只安装一个宝塔面板。这是因为宝塔面板主要作用是作为服务器管理工具,用于简化网站、数据库等服务的部署与管理。如果在同一台服务器上安装多个宝塔面板,不仅会增加系统资源的消耗,还可能导致配置冲突,影响服务器的稳定性和安全性。

分析与探讨

1. 系统资源消耗

宝塔面板本身是一个相对轻量级的应用程序,但它仍然需要占用一定的CPU、内存和磁盘资源。如果在同一台服务器上安装多个宝塔面板,这些资源会被重复占用,导致系统性能下降,尤其是在处理高负载任务时,可能会出现资源不足的情况。

2. 配置冲突

宝塔面板通过端口监听来提供管理界面和服务。默认情况下,宝塔面板使用8888端口。如果在同一台服务器上安装多个宝塔面板,每个面板都需要绑定不同的端口,这不仅增加了配置的复杂性,还可能因为端口冲突导致某些面板无法正常启动或访问。

3. 安全性问题

安装多个宝塔面板会增加服务器的安全风险。每个宝塔面板都有自己的登录凭据和配置文件,如果其中一个面板被攻击者利用,可能会波及其他面板和整个服务器的安全。此外,多个面板的存在也增加了管理员管理和维护的难度,容易出现疏漏。

4. 管理复杂度

虽然宝塔面板旨在简化服务器管理,但如果在同一台服务器上安装多个面板,反而会增加管理的复杂度。管理员需要记住多个面板的登录信息,并且在进行日常维护和故障排查时,需要在多个面板之间切换,这无疑增加了工作负担。

解决方案

如果你确实有多个独立的项目或网站需要管理,建议采用以下几种方法:

  1. 多站点支持:宝塔面板本身就支持在一个面板中管理多个网站和应用。你可以通过添加多个虚拟主机来实现这一点,这样既方便又高效。

  2. 多云服务器:如果单个云服务器的资源不足以支持所有项目,可以考虑使用多台云服务器,每台服务器安装一个宝塔面板,分别管理不同的项目或网站。

  3. 容器化技术:使用Docker等容器化技术,可以在同一台服务器上运行多个隔离的环境,每个环境可以独立配置和管理,而不需要安装多个宝塔面板。

综上所述,虽然从技术上讲,一个云服务器可以安装多个宝塔面板,但从实际应用的角度来看,这样做并不推荐。合理规划和选择适合的管理方式,才能更好地发挥云服务器的效能,确保系统的稳定性和安全性。